Shenyang Longemont Integrated Development, comprising Shenyang Longemont Shopping Mall, Shenyang Red Star Macalline Furniture Mall and Shenyang Longemont Offices, is one of the largest mixed-use commercial developments in China with a total gross floor area of about 8.7 million square feet.
Located in Dadong District, Shenyang Longemont Integrated Development sits within the Shenyang Longemont Asia Pacific City ("APC") which comprises other operational developments such as 4-star and 5-star hotels, residential apartments, an IMAX cinema and wholesale centres.
Prominently located along Shenyang's First Ring Road and well-served by extensive road infrastructure, the integrated development also enjoys direct connectivity to the Shenyang APC Transportation Hub, which incorporates the Pangjiang Street Subway Station (serving the operational Subway Line 1 and future Subway Line 10), taxi services, as well as a long and short-distance bus interchange serving 16 inter-city and 90 intra-city bus lines.
Shenyang Longemont Offices, comprising two 56-storey Grade 'A' office towers sitting atop the Shenyang Longemont Shopping Mall, is an ideal office address for companies seeking a prime location with excellent transport connectivity and good supporting amenities in the fast-growing city. The office blocks currently house a variety of multi-national and local companies from the insurance, media, investment, business consultancy, and information technology industries.
